THE OPPORTUNITY
We’re looking for a New Zealand Digital Adoption Lead to drive the adoption of digital processes, systems, solutions and system products across New Zealand. This includes promoting digital best practices, tools, and methodologies and fostering a culture of innovation. The role will identify opportunities for Mott MacDonald to provide our digital tools and solutions to both internal and external clients to enhance efficiency, reduce costs, add value and improve user experience. This role is to be based in our Auckland office.
The role will be measured by collaborating with digital team members throughout New Zealand and globally, to help them adopt best practice digital solutions and system products that enable our digital service offering in an efficient and effective way.
This role will see you supporting the implementation of a comprehensive digital strategy, identifying key opportunities where digital can improve outcomes. Engaging with key business stakeholders including sector and bid leads, practices and digital delivery personnel to drive awareness of APNA Digital Services and Mott MacDonald’s digital service offerings for project delivery
The role includes creation of use cases, providing presentation and solution showcases, contributing to bids and proposals from a technical and commercial perspective, and liaising with specialist digital teams tasked with delivering solutions.
